MeiliSearch Alternatives
-
sonic
🦔 Fast, lightweight & schema-less search backend. An alternative to Elasticsearch that runs on a few MBs of RAM.
-
rust
Empowering everyone to build reliable and efficient software.
-
Scout
Get performance insights in less than 4 minutes. Scout APM uses tracing logic that ties bottlenecks to source code so you know the exact line of code causing performance issues and can get back to building a great product faster.
-
ruffle
A Flash Player emulator written in Rust
-
Typesense
Fast, typo tolerant, fuzzy search engine for building delightful search experiences ⚡ 🔍
-
Toshi
A full-text search engine in rust
-
rust-blog
Educational blog posts for Rust beginners
-
solana
Web-Scale Blockchain for fast, secure, scalable, decentralized apps and marketplaces.
-
duckdf
🦆 SQL for R dataframes, with ducks
-
alacritty
A cross-platform, OpenGL terminal emulator.
-
Rustlings
:crab: Small exercises to get you used to reading and writing Rust code!
-
ClickHouse
ClickHouse® is a free analytics DBMS for big data
-
tikv
Distributed transactional key-value database, originally created to complement TiDB
-
py-spy
Sampling profiler for Python programs
-
ecto
A toolkit for data mapping and language integrated query.
-
Apache Solr
Apache Lucene and Solr open-source search software
-
VictoriaMetrics
VictoriaMetrics: fast, cost-effective monitoring solution and time series database
-
PyO3
Rust bindings for the Python interpreter [Moved to: https://github.com/PyO3/pyo3]
-
rust
Rust language bindings for TensorFlow (by tensorflow)
-
ggez
Rust library to create a Good Game Easily
-
Parity
The fast, light, and robust client for the Ethereum mainnet.
Posts
-
ClickHouse as an alternative to Elasticsearch for log storage and analysis
https://github.com/meilisearch/MeiliSearch gets a lot of traction recently. There is also Sphinx and its fork https://manticoresearch.com/ - very lightweight and fast.
-
How to Save and Search Your Slack History on a Free Slack Plan
Specifically, we will export messages from your Slack instance into an open-source search engine called MeiliSearch. We will be focusing on getting this setup running from your local workstation. We will mention at the end how you can set up a more productionized version of this pipeline.
-
Luckily there are faster and smaller alternatives in Rust for the ElasticSearch - Toshi[1], Meili[2] and Sonic[3]. In the age of Rust there is no need to use JVMs overhead.
[1] https://github.com/toshi-search/Toshi
-
Rusticles #20 - Wed Nov 18 2020
meilisearch/MeiliSearch (Rust): Lightning Fast, Ultra Relevant, and Typo-Tolerant Search Engine
-
Rusticles #10 - Wed Sep 09 2020
meilisearch/MeiliSearch (Rust): Lightning Fast, Ultra Relevant, and Typo-Tolerant Search Engine
Stats
meilisearch/MeiliSearch is an open source project licensed under MIT License which is an OSI approved license.